Back-back-room meetings

The New York Times reports Democratic Party big shots have met privately to avoid a trainwreck at the party's convention in Denver this summer.

The second graph in the NYTimes story sums it up: "Democratic Party officials said that in the past week Mr. (Al) Gore and other leading Democrats had held private talks as worry mounted that the close race between Senators Barack Obama and Hillary Rodham Clinton could be decided by a group of 795 party insiders known as superdelegates."

In other words, back-room meetings to avoid back-room meetings.

You can't make this stuff up.
